Chesapeake Midstream Salary

How much does the Chesapeake Midstream Pay for employees?

As of August 2026, the average weekly salary for employees at Chesapeake Midstream in the United States is $1,745.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$90,723. Salaries at Chesapeake Midstream typically range from $1,537 to $1,968 weekly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Chesapeake Midstream’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Canton?

Understanding the cost of living near Canton is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Chesapeake Midstream.
Canton's Cost of Living Index is approximately 76.3 (23.7% less expensive than US average; 15.9% less than OH average). NE OH city (Pro Football HOF), very affordable. SARTA. When planning your budget based on a salary from Chesapeake Midstream,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$650 - $1,000+ A significant portion of Chesapeake Midstream sal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$45 (SART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$350 - $520 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$280 - $550+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$340 - $630+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$1,815 - $2,955+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
